Output 8b77424a309ee08467e135787eb8f2df09a1e743f47bde0247edf98068ffb289:3

value
683406
script pubkey
OP_0 OP_PUSHBYTES_20 cc7866bf2d70c6b87aef0ff58cb6b75a7fdc7c7f
address
bc1qe3uxd0edwrrts7h0pl6ced4htflaclrl6r6nxh
transaction
8b77424a309ee08467e135787eb8f2df09a1e743f47bde0247edf98068ffb289
spent
true